1 Samuel 7:3-11
New American Standard Bible
Chapter 7
3Then Samuel spoke to all the house of Israel, saying, 'If you are returning to the LORD with all your heart, then remove the foreign gods and the Ashtaroth from among you, and direct your hearts to the LORD and serve Him alone; and He will save you from the hand of the Philistines.' 4So the sons of Israel removed the Baals and the Ashtaroth, and served the LORD alone.
5Then Samuel said, 'Gather all Israel to Mizpah and I will pray to the LORD for you.'
6So they gathered to Mizpah, and drew water and poured it out before the LORD, and fasted on that day and said there, 'We have sinned against the LORD.' And Samuel judged the sons of Israel at Mizpah.
7Now when the Philistines heard that the sons of Israel had gathered at Mizpah, the governors of the Philistines went up against Israel. And when the sons of Israel heard about it, they were afraid of the Philistines.
8So the sons of Israel said to Samuel, 'Do not stop crying out to the LORD our God for us, that He will save us from the hand of the Philistines!'
9Samuel took a nursing lamb and offered it as a whole burnt offering to the LORD; and Samuel cried out to the LORD for Israel, and the LORD answered him.
10Now Samuel was offering up the burnt offering, and the Philistines advanced to battle Israel. But the LORD thundered with a great thunder on that day against the Philistines and confused them, so that they were struck down before Israel.
11And the men of Israel came out of Mizpah and pursued the Philistines, and killed them as far as below Beth-car.
